## Changelog — Passkey Reset Revamp (Vexlane Auth)

Defaults changed for the password reset flow: reset tokens now expire after 15 minutes instead of 60, single-use enforcement is on by default, and rate limiting applies per account rather than per IP. Reviewers should verify these against the staging profile. The effective defaults are listed below.

service settings:
PRAIX_LOG_LEVEL=error
PRAIX_METRICS_HOST=metrics.praix.qorvelcorp.corp
PRAIX_POOL_SIZE=16

## Ownership: Order-Cutoff Rule

Hey plugin authors — quick note on the cutoff logic. Crumbline enforces a hard order-cutoff for next-day bakery orders, and plugins must not override or delay it, since the ovens literally get scheduled off that number. If your plugin needs to read the cutoff, use the public hook; if you think you need an exception, you'll have to ask first. The person who owns the cutoff rule is named below.

approver of hahig-kahap = Fraeth Nordor Normir

- [ ] **Step 7: Breaker override escrow.** After sealing the signing keys for the Tallgrove upstream API circuit breaker, confirm the support team can force the breaker open during a full outage. The override bundle lives in the sealed escrow drawer and is useless without its unlock phrase. Two ceremony witnesses must initial this step before proceeding. The escrow bundle is decrypted with the recovery passphrase that follows.

vault phrase of kahip-kahop = holath-quenmir

Handover: Password Reset Revamp — Keelbright Auth

Welcome aboard. Marta and I split the reset flow into token issuance and verification stages; both now live in the resetd service. Please read the sequence diagram in the Keelbright wiki before touching code. Rate limiting is enforced at the gateway, not in resetd itself, so don't duplicate it. Token TTLs, hashing parameters, and the mailer endpoint are all environment-driven rather than hardcoded. The current configuration values for the staging deployment are as follows.

service settings:
novath:
  pin: 1396
  tenant: pelys
  seal: seal_ccc035e1
  metrics_host: metrics.novath.qorvelworks.test
  standby_team: fraeth
  escalation: drueth-zorok
  nonce: 61d508